Sec. 302. Conforming amendments

Section 4A of the Ports and Waterways Safety Act ( 33 U.S.C. 1223a )— is redesignated as section 3105 of title 46, United States Code, and transferred to appear after section 3104 of that title; and is amended by striking subsection
(b)and inserting the following: Except pursuant to an international treaty, convention, or agreement, to which the United States is a party, this section shall not apply to any foreign vessel that is not destined for, or departing from, a port or place subject to the jurisdiction of the United States and that is in— innocent passage through the territorial sea of the United States; or transit through the navigable waters of the United States that form a part of an international strait. . The analysis at the beginning of chapter 31 of such title is amended by adding at the end the following: 3105. Electronic charts. . Section 2307 of title 46, United States Code, and the item relating to that section in the analysis at the beginning of chapter 23 of that title, are repealed. The Ports and Waterways Safety Act ( 33 U.S.C. 1221 et seq.), as amended by this Act, is repealed.
